边缘计算是一种新兴的计算模型,它将计算和数据存储推向网络边缘,以便更好地满足低延迟、实时性和带宽限制等要求。在设计边缘计算应用程序时,有几个关键的设计要点需要考虑。本文将介绍这些要点,并提供相应的源代码示例。
- 低延迟通信:边缘计算应用程序需要减少与云端的通信延迟,因此应优先在边缘设备上处理和响应数据。为了实现低延迟通信,可以使用轻量级的消息传递机制,如MQTT(Message Queuing Telemetry Transport)。下面是一个使用Python和Paho MQTT库的示例代码:
import paho.mqtt.client as mqtt
# 连接到MQTT代理
client = mqtt.Client()
client.connect
本文探讨了设计边缘计算应用程序的关键点,包括低延迟通信,资源优化,安全性和隐私保护,以及本地处理和推理。示例代码展示了如何使用MQTT、MicroPython和TensorFlow Lite来实现这些目标。
订阅专栏 解锁全文
69

被折叠的 条评论
为什么被折叠?



